When it comes to sneaker culture, few shoes have made as big an impact as the Nike Dunk SB. Originally introduced as a basketball shoe in the 1980s, the Dunk was reimagined in the early 2000s as part of Nike's Skateboarding (SB) line. This transformation not only breathed new life into the iconic silhouette but also cemented its place in sneaker history.
The Nike Dunk SB was designed to cater to the needs of skateboarders, featuring a thicker tongue for added comfort, Zoom Air insoles for enhanced cushioning, and a grippy outsole for better board feel. However, its appeal quickly transcended skateboarding, becoming a favorite among sneaker enthusiasts and fashion-forward individuals alike.One of the defining characteristics of the Nike Dunk SB is its collaboration with artists, designers, and brands. Over the years, Nike has partnered with notable names like Supreme, Travis Scott, and Concepts to release limited-edition colorways that often sell out within minutes.
